CHARLOTTESVILLE, Va. – Taylor Ruden has been named assistant coach for the Virginia rowing program, head coach Wesley Ng announced Wednesday (July 24).

Ruden joins Ng’s staff at UVA after serving as assistant coach at Ohio State the past four seasons from 2020-24. Ruden helped the Buckeyes to the Big Ten Championship in 2022 and four NCAA championship appearances, including a top-10 finishes in 2021 and 2022. She coached the Buckeyes’ Second Varsity Eight to gold at the 2023 Big Ten Championships and eighth-place finish at the NCAA Championships.

“I am thrilled to be joining Wes and the women’s rowing staff at UVA,” Ruden said. “The successful history of this program and the people that have been created along the way is something I can’t wait to be a part of.”

In Ruden’s first season at Ohio State in 2020-21, the Buckeyes finished second in the Big Ten and sixth at the NCAA Championships. Ohio State finished 12th at the NCAA Championship in each of the past two seasons. Ruden coached eight All-Americans at Ohio State.

Ruden also spent one year as an assistant at her alma mater, Indiana, in 2019-20 and three seasons at Navy from 2016-19. While with Navy, she was part of a staff that earned back-to-back CRCA Region 2 Staff of the Year honors as the Midshipmen earned Patriot League titles in her two seasons. She coached the Varsity Four, which finished a program-best 14th at the 2018 NCAA Championships, and one All-American at Navy.

During her time as a student-athlete in Bloomington, Ruden competed as a coxswain with the Hoosiers’ crew team. She coxed the Varsity Four to a 13th-place finish at the 2015 NCAA Championships and Varsity Eight to a 16th-place national finish as a senior in 2016. Ruden graduated from Indiana’s Kelley School of Business with a degree in marketing in May of 2016.
